    This semi-detached freehold property on Earls Crescent last sold in November 2007 for £337,500. Based on price growth in the HA1 district since then, its estimated current value is £600,495 — placing it in the 86th percentile nationally and the 73rd percentile within HA1. The property covers 99 m² (1,066 sq ft), giving an estimated value of £6,066 per m². The EPC rating is D, with a potential rating of D.

    District Context — HA1

    HA1 covers Harrow and surrounding areas in northwest London, positioned between central London and the Metropolitan Green Belt. It is a diverse, densely populated district with a strong professional workforce and significant private rental market.
